Trump’s proposed new rule is a rollback of what’s called Corporate Average Fuel Economy, or CAFE, standards. CAFE standards essentially set a minimum level for how fuel efficient new cars need to be. But they're assessed on the automaking companies (Ford, GM, Tesla, etc) and they’re based on the average fuel economy of the automakers whole fleet. So if GM wants to sell more pickup trucks, they also need to sell more compact cars. The fastest way to increase average fuel economy is to make more cars and trucks run on electricity. No gasoline = no emissions and a CAFE impact of zero
